花椒毒酚

分析标准品,HPLC≥98%

Xanthotol

CAS号:2009-24-7

分子式:C11H6O4

分子量:202.16

MDLMFCD00017408

别名:花椒毒酚; 8-羟基补骨脂素

产品介绍

熔点:250℃

沸点:428.1℃ at 760mmHg

外观:无色晶体

溶解性:可溶于氯仿、乙酸乙酯、DMSO等溶剂,不溶于水。

储存条件:2-8℃
